Once reluctant, my sister has found the joy in ocean swells that I promised her, with the help of a yellow boogie board. Above clouds shift back and forth covering the sun, the prospect darkening to the east. Sea birds fly near the surface, their white wings green from reflecting waves. The sea is mysterious, the sky uncertain. But I watch in this moment and am content.
